Default Shrimp vs Pods

So I have been thinking of adding a few shrimp to the tank, not sure what kind yet, but I wonder, how well would they survive being scavengers?
I have a lot of pods... A LOT. I have no brittle stars any more the pods have out competed them, I think I'm down to 1 or 2 bristle worms, if any... The pods are everywhere, like a giant colony of ants. I know I should control my feedings better, but I dont want them getting hungry and snacking on the coral/zoas, plus its more for feeding the coral. I would love to add some type of dragonet, but I dont think I'm brave enough to add one.

Would the insane ammounts of pods out compete the shrimp?
